KARACHI (92 News) – Pak Sarzameen Party (PSP) chief Mustafa Kamal on Thursday said that the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) government lied with nation on the matter of jobs and homes. Speaking outside the accountability court, Mustafa Kamal mentioned that the Nespak informed about the ending of K-4 project in Karachi. “No one aware was aware about this update,” he added. “The Sindh government is doing as per its aspirations so it is need of hour that the people should come out from houses against the government for the future of their children,” he maintained. He also termed the allegations of illegal allotment of public land against him as baseless. Commenting on the current political scenario and Jamiat JUI-F’s anti-government protest ‘Azadi March’, the former Karachi mayor said that Fazlur Rehman was disrespected and now a committee has been formed for holding talks with him. “At this time, a war is ongoing in the country to overthrow the government from power,” he said. He said that the prime minister obtained votes, during the elections, in the name of providing 10 million jobs to youths and five million houses. The PSP chief urged the public to actively participate in the demonstration and claimed that the country could not proceed with “such an outdated system”. “This system is not for a common man, everyone is uncertain about the state of affairs in the country,” he said. “In all provinces, chief ministers contain all powers constitutional amendments are required to transfer the powers to the grassroots,” he mentioned, adding that the situation would improve after powers are transferred to district level.
